The highest wind speed officially reported in Colorado is 148 mph in February of 2016 on Monarch Pass. While the 148 miles per hour mark is the highest official wind speed to be clocked, a special project conducted by the Rocky Mountain Nature Association reportedly measured winds on top of Longs Peak at 201 miles per hour during the winter of 1981. The old record was a 147 mph gust recorded at the National Center for Atmospheric Research (NCAR) in Boulder on January 25, 1971, according to the Colorado State Climatologist who told the Weather Service that was the "accepted, yet unofficial highest recorded wind gust in Colorado.". While the foothills area of southeastern Wyoming and Colorado experienced a number of strong Chinook events in January 1982, the most severe episodes took place on January 17 and on January 24, two consecutive Sundays. Why is it so windy?There are two main reasons for Colorado being so windy: pressure differences over the mountains and plains, and Chinook winds.
